Codename Nemo: Windows Live meets Media Center

Codename Nemo is designed to be an add-on for Windows Vista (Home Premium and Vista Ultimate editions), that integrates Spaces, Messenger and Live Call into a UI designed for large monitors and TVs. Nemo essentially creates a Windows Live Media …

Expo launches UK Beta

Windows Live Expo

After its US release a while back, Expo has finally launched in limited beta at http://expo.live.co.uk/ today. Windows Live Expo is Microsoft's online classifieds service, providing users with a free way to advertise items they want to sell, or services …
